Yconimarie, n. (Var., with agent-suffix -arie (L. -ārius), of Yconomy n. a.) —1562 Mar & Kellie Doc. (Cambuskenneth) (Reg. H.).
The office of yconimus and procurator of our said abbay … induring the tyme of his said office of yconimarie and procuratorie
